N52 headers install
How hard was it for y'all to install headers on a n52 and what kind did you go with? Thanks

It was harder than you would guess, it took me like 8 hours on jackstands. It’s not complicated and you don’t need any special expertise, but it’s just time consuming. I definitely recommend you don’t tackle it alone it’s nice having someone working from the top side while the other guy works from under the car.
I installed the AA Catless headers on mine.

Yeah 8 hours sounds about right. The hardest part is reinstalling the o2 sensorsand getting everything torqued up. The catless aa headers made it a little more difficult since both of the o2 sensors are now in the downstream.

Quite a pita. I'd say the easiest way to do it is remove all o2 sensors, remove coolant expansion tank and get yourself a very slim electric ratchet to undo all nuts. Biggest issue for me was getting the old manifolds out from the bottom of the car
